Garitano: “We’re going for the second win in a row”

Gaizka Garitano previews Athletic’s match against Getafe, “one of the most difficult teams to beat in LaLiga”

Athletic Club head-coach Gaizka Garitano has stressed the need to start winning consecutive matches.

The Lions travel down to Madrid to face Getafe at the Coliseum Alfonso Pérez (Sun. 16:15 CET) and will be looking to notch consecutive wins for the first time in their 2020-21 LaLiga Santander campaign.

“We’re coming off the back of a run where we win one, then lose the next,” Garitano said at his pre-match press conference in Lezama. “We need to win again and put two consecutive victories together.

“That’s what really makes a win good. This is what all the teams want, but it’s difficult to achieve in the First Division.”

Athletic are currently eighth in a very tight LaLiga Santander table. Three more points could see the Lions move further towards the European spots.

At the moment only two points separate Athletic and sixth-placed Granada.

“It’s usually always like this at the beginning of the season,” Garitano added. “A win one week can put you towards the top and a loss the next week can put you towards the bottom.

“We’re not looking at the table, we’re looking at the day-to-day, at the work in Lezama.

“We fully trust the work the team is doing and we’re sure it will bring positive results.”

Garitano is conscious that Sunday’s opponents Getafe CF will ensure the match is a completely different sort of match to that of this past Monday’s fixture against Real Betis.

“Getafe are a tough and competitive team, one of the hardest to beat in LaLiga,” Garitano concluded.

“They’ve had some good seasons and they make things difficult for every opponent.

“We know what we have to do, we’ve worked well on it and we’re going for a second consecutive win with everything we’ve got.”
